 'The Forest of Allund'  is a fantasy tale told in the first person in the past tense. The story revolves around a young wise man, Mage Alexio who has achieved distinction in his studies at the Mages Academy. "A Mage is honest in his words and deeds." Alex naturally is a principled man, morally and ethically bound to the admirable value systems in life. As a peace lover, declining the attractive opportunities offered to him by a city ruler, he has chosen to defend his favourite place ... 'Allund Forest' with its myths and mysteries. He joins his old acquaintances ... 'talking' intelligent animals in the forest. He wants to take the responsibility to save the forest and his friends from the intruders. There he meets a wandering Amazon woman "Philie".


He faces challenges from a dominating barbarian enemy. With the help of his friends and legendary mythical "Old Ones", he thwarts the attack temporarily. Pleased, his superiors confer him with certain administrative powers and his fame begins to spread. His responsibilities get expanded..


'New' challenges arise from an unexpected enemy. Alex takes his own hard decision beyond his conferred powers; despite a dilemma between his moral codes and a need to protect the motherland... "When faced with a complex problem, try to view it from as many angles as you can. One way of viewing should offer a solution.”


Alex faces a trial, although he had fought with his enemies, only to save his motherland. But his leaders who celebrated him before, soon begin to hate him and fear his magical powers and rising popularity. They want his help to protect them in emergencies, but at the same time, they want to suppress him, using his innocence. Ulterior motives, cunningness, fear syndromes and power games begin to rule. It angers Alex. 


Alex, an outcast, now is disheartened. He finds his cherished values in life have no meaning. The deceitful enemies make Alex decide ...well, what's that? What's that 'new' challenge which changed the course of his destiny?


The story has a good start and an entertainment quotient, due to attention to the details. Its good features like the flow, absorbing style, editing, fluid narratives and dialogues, appeals to me in many aspects of realistic portrayals of Alex. I appreciate the creativity in the memorable characterization of Alex, his noble fair-minded outlooks; besides the true depiction of certain characters ... loyal 'Amazon' Philie, Cleon, Melina, Pallas, and Lycus. A good and uniqueness in the portrayal of the world of strange magic, mythical creatures and talking animals, add liveliness to the story. 


The author has kept me pretty indulged in the interleaved sub-stories depicting: 1) Love between Alex and Melina; 2) Amazing Magical skills of Alex; 3) Sacrosanct friendships; 4) Battles; 5) Adventures. 


Well, it is a very simple storyline. Some twists would have made the reading more interesting! Yes, the story has dragged due to lengthier and repetitive narratives. I sometimes felt I was lost in the 'forest' due to the excessive dosage of Greek words which deter the flow; also, the author has used so many names, sometimes confusing, which impedes the ease in reading. There are certain unconvincing and missed aspects leading to confusion. In essence, a reader can enjoy this book if he devotes good attention.


I have rated the book 4 stars, despite the shortcomings due to the author's delivery of some special aspects: 1) The author has insightfully portrayed the core of the human psyche, explaining the ugly minds. 2) Beautiful depictions of war which happens within ourselves and with others in our daily life. 3)bSome hidden touches of sarcasm and subtle hints for the current leaders. 4) Alex's character etched with ethics, philosophy, morality, has offered something to human society… that it is a human tendency to always take control of others advantageously, with selfish motives. And how an innocent Alex is exposed to the new vistas. 

 

If you are interested in a book filled with adventure, magic, myth, mystery, gruesome punishments, please read this book.
